Hochstein Expressive Arts Faculty - Katie Maya

Instrument/Department: Expressive Arts - Music Therapy

Joined Hochstein faculty in: Spring 2023

 

Katie Maya grew up in Rhode Island, where she spent the majority of her time involved in musical activities. She was a member of her school choirs and an all-ages community choir, often accompanying both with her guitar. Katie also participated in Rhode Island’s All-State Music Festival throughout her high school career. 

Katie graduated from Nazareth College in May 2022 with a Bachelor of Music in Music Therapy. She completed her music therapy internship at St. Ann’s Community where she facilitated individual and group music therapy sessions for elders living with dementia and other age-related diagnoses. Katie also has experience working with adults with developmental disabilities and adults who experience speech-language disorders as the result of a stroke. 

Katie is grateful for the experiences she has had throughout her education and she is thrilled to be a part of the Hochstein School!
